Abstract

In this research, a comparative study is conducted between the International Roughness Index (IRI), Pavement Condition Index (PCI), and Bina Marga method on roadways with a flexible pavement structure. The objective is to compare the results of road damage evaluation using these three methods and formulate appropriate treatment programs. The research findings indicate that overall, the IRI method provides an overview of the road surface roughness level. The majority of the analyzed data falls under the "Moderate" category with a value of 7.2. The PCI method measures the physical condition of the road infrastructure, which is categorized as "Fair" with a value of 41.2. On the other hand, the Bina Marga method assesses the type of road maintenance, which is categorized as "Routine Maintenance" with a value of 6.8. Enhancing road maintenance practices is necessary to address minor damages such as small cracks or surface irregularities that affect road user comfort.

Abstract

This research aims to generate the theme of urban parks by developing urban areas towards livable cities. Qualitative and quantitative descriptive methods are operated to identify the availability of urban parks, discover the characteristics of urban development areas, and arrange the theme of a park. Eight themes could be adopted: history and culture, entertainment, hobbies, health, conservation, hazard mitigation, branding, and education. The objective of urban development areas, structure plan, land use, and specific characteristics of an area are considered when selecting the theme of the urban parks. As a primer area in development, WP I has more variety in urban park themes than the others.

Abstract

Land use is a characteristic of the arrangements, activities, and contributions made by humans to either effect changes or maintain a certain type of land cover (Gregorio and Jansen, 1998). Agricultural land is a crucial resource for sustainability and food security. In an effort to control and anticipate the conversion of agricultural land, the Bantul Regency Government has issued Regional Regulation No. 10 of 2023 on the Protection of Sustainable Food Agricultural Land, with a total area of 12,831 hectares. However, the area designated for protection according to the 2021 study recommendations is 14,407.50 hectares. This represents a reduction of 1,576 hectares due to agricultural land in Sewon and Kasihan Districts being planned for non-agricultural use. Therefore, the objective of this study is to identify the modeling of sustainable food agricultural land designation in Bantul Regency, using a linear programming optimization approach with the aid of Microsoft Excel Solver. The linear programming model, with the objective function to minimize the area designated in the regional regulation, determined the need for 11,356.52 hectares of agricultural land to maintain food security in Bantul Regency over a period of 20 years.

Abstract

The density of activities that take place around the operating facilities at Andi Djemma Masamba Airport so that the Management of the Andi Jemma Airport Operator Unit (UPBU) Office has launched the development of Andi Djemma Masamba Airport as an aviation company so that it continues to carry out various facility improvements, especially in risk prevention with potential activities with high losses, therefore it is necessary to conduct research to find out how to map, risk assessment and design a risk control and mitigation system at the Operations facility at Andi Djemma Masamba Airport caused by activities that have the potential to cause risk. The stages of the risk management process refer to ISO 31000: 2018 including risk identification, risk analysis and risk evaluation. Expected impact and likelihood of occurrence are mapped through the risk matrix from the Federation Aviation Administration (FAA). The results showed that at the andi djemma masamba airport there were 6 events that fell into the red category, namely Aircraft accidents during take off/landing, Aircraft accidents in the apron area, Escape of dangerous goods into the aircraft, Fuel Spills on the Apron/Taxiway, Lack of building maintenance, The security inspection process is less than optimal.

Abstract

Basic services are government affairs that are mandatory and entitled to be obtained by every citizen, one of which is public transportation services. Although it has been regulated by Minimum Service Standards (SPM), the quality of public transportation services in Makassar City is still low and has not met expectations and satisfaction, especially for female passengers. The purpose of this study was to determine the satisfaction of female passengers with the quality of public transportation services in Makassar City. The respondents of this study were 96 female passengers of public transportation in Makassar City. This research is descriptive qualitative study that refers to the Regulation of the Minister of Transportation of the Republic of Indonesia Number PM 29 of 2015. This regulation outlines criteria such as security, safety, comfort, affordability, equality, and regularity for assessing the quality of public transportation services in Makassar City. The data analysis technique in this study uses descriptive analysis employing the Community Satisfaction Indicator (SMI) analysis method. Based on the results of calculations using the public satisfaction index method, it is known that the total number of service elements has a score of 43.86. Although this indicates that the overall quality of service is quite good, it is considered that women are not satisfied with the service provided. The relationship between the level of satisfaction with the quality of service affects women's preferences in choosing the mode they want to use.

Abstract

In an aquaponics system, the electricity produced by photovoltaic solar power (PLTS) is stored in batteries and used to power the water pumps. Using natural microorganisms to transform fish waste into plant nutrients, aquaponics is a cultivation method that blends fish and plant cultivation. The aquaponics system helps reduce the amount of trash released into the environment and is beneficial to the environment. The main goal of this study is to evaluate an off-grid PLTS system's functionality as a DC water pump power source in an aquaponics setting. This study's goal is to evaluate how well the PLTS operates when powering the DC water pump that circulates water in the aquaponics system.According to performance tests, the off-grid PLTS generates an average energy of 503.8 Wh, which is enough to power the DC pump for 20 hours a day of water circulation. The water pump uses only 382.6 Wh of electricity each day. With an average solar panel efficiency of 4.97%, an average solar charge controller (SCC) efficiency of 60.51%, and an average pump efficiency of 79.91%, the Off-grid PLTS demonstrates efficiency. With a daily solar irradiation of 7.8 kWh/m2, the average energy loss in the solar panel is 5.29 kWh/kWp, whereas the average energy loss in the system is 0.10 kWh/kWp. All things considered, these results provide insight into how well the Off-grid PLTS functions as a power source for the DC water pump in an aquaponics system.

Abstract

The higher practice of private car use in DKI Jakarta amid the implementation of the TDM strategy that continues to be developed leads to increased traffic congestion, which in turn causes economic losses, deteriorated air quality, and an increase in acute respiratory tract infection cases. Innovation is needed in the pull strategy of DKI Jakarta residents to suppress this behavior, especially those who have (access to) private vehicles to switch to public transportation. This study tries to analyze the effect of gamification on the behavioral intentions of DKI Jakarta residents (choice users) to use public transit for their daily activities (school/college/work). Modifications to the Theory of Planned Behavior (TPB) were carried out to investigate the influence of gamification through attitudes and behavioral control on behavioral intentions to use public transportation. The theory was tested using questionnaire data from 200 respondents with SEM-PLS analysis. The elements of points, levels, rewards, and games are used as indicators of gamification. This study shows that gamification positively and significantly affects attitudes and behavioral control. The study findings confirm the significant positive influence of attitudes on behavioral intentions to use public transportation. The results of this research can also be used as material for consideration in pull strategy (TDM) policy innovation in DKI Jakarta.

Abstract

Environmental sustainability is an urgent priority in dealing with waste management problems in Indonesian cities, one of which is Lubuk Linggau City. In the 2012-2032 Lubuk Linggau City RTRW, waste management standards have been set using the Controlled Landfill or Sanitary Landfill method, but in reality the Lubuk Binjai landfillstill adopts the Open Dumping method. This waste management not in accordance with environmentally sound waste management methods, so it is necessary to develop a waste management strategy for the Binjai Landfill. This research aims to identify priority strategies that can be applied in developing landfill waste management in Lubuk Linggau City using the Analytical Hierarchy Process (AHP) method. Data collection was carried out by conducting interviews with key informants who were managers of the Lubuk Binjai waste disposal site. Determination of criteria and sub-criteria based on previous literature studies and determination of alternative strategies based on the Lubuk Linggau City RTRW for 2021-2032. From the results of the analysis, it shows that the prioritized strategy is the Strategy for Improving Waste Management Methods Technology, with alternatives such as recycling processing, compost, and more sophisticated waste management technology such as controlled burning or anaerobic management. This is appropriate and crucial in overcoming problems at the Lubuk Binjai waste disposal site, that the Open Dumping method is still applied. It is hoped that the implementation of this strategy can bring positive and sustainable changes in waste management in Lubuk Linggau City.

Abstract

The absence of individualized tutorials during regular school hours has resulted in a suboptimal learning method at Vocational High Schools(SMK), limiting students' ability to reach their optimum competency. Several Computerized self-study systems have been created as potential solutions to these challenges. Regrettably, a notable drawback of the system lies in its failure to address students' diverse range of abilities adequately. This study presents a proposed model for an Intelligent Tutoring System (ITS) utilizing the Bayesian Network (BN) at Vocational High Schools. The model aims to assess students' proficiency levels and deliver skill-based instructional materials tailored to individual students' abilities. This type of research is called research and development (RD), to develop and know the validity of a product. The system under development will undergo trials within the Computer and Network Engineering (TKJ) program at SMK Negeri 4 Gowa. These trials will employ a quasi-experimental approach, explicitly utilizing a one-group pretest-posttest design.The findings indicated that there were notable disparities in the learning outcomes of students following the implementation of the proposed ITS. To put it otherwise, the proposed ITS has improved students' proficiency in Vocational High Schools. The evaluation outcomes suggest that the BN model had a significant level of accuracy, reaching 84%.
